
Having upgraded to a considerably more spacious Barbara Bestor-designed contemporary home in L.A.’s perennially trendy Silver Lake neighborhood, OneRepublic bassist and cellist Brent Kutzle has hoisted his former home, also in Silver Lake, on the market at $3.5 million. The veteran rock musician, who has also written scores of songs for pop divas like Beyoncé, Ellie Goulding and Kelly Clarkson, purchased the boxy modern almost three years ago for $2.425 million.
Described in listings held by Jenna Cooper and Caroline Wolf of Compass as an “urban oasis,” the clean-lined contemporary organic-meets-vintage-glam property includes a four bedroom and three-and-a-half-bath main house plus a detached studio-style guesthouse converted to a black-walled screening room that’s complete with a kitchenette and bath.
With the assistance of Night Palm’s Tiffany Howell, Kutzle and wife Jackie Leslie filled the 3,200-square-foot two-story home with what Lonny magazine described as “modern metallic accents, vintage furniture, printed wallpaper and statement light fixtures,” such as the delicate glass pendant hanging over the stairs.
The main floor living and entertaining spaces, which include a simple but chic midcentury modern-inspired kitchen, are tucked away at the back of the house, behind the street-facing two-car garage and long entrance gallery. Both the living room and kitchen spill out through glass sliders to a curtained dining terrace enveloped in mature plantings.
Upstairs, one of the three average sized guest bedrooms has a private bath, while the other two share a hall bath and the primary bedroom has a small bathroom of its own, along with a good-sized walk-in closet/dressing room and glass sliders to a sun-splashed deck.
The property’s real draw, however, just might be beguiling gardens, which were created in conjunction with The Tropics Inc. Bougainvillea frames the the glass sliders on the small deck outside the living room, like flaming fuchsia eye brows, and mature olive trees mix with spiky succulents, delicate palm trees, and small bits of lush grass. Beside the guesthouse/screening room, a cushioned built-in bench alongside the dark-bottom swimming pool and spa makes for a sweet spot to dry off and soak up some sun, while raised bed planters let the urban gardener exercise their green thumb.
Married in 2017, Kutzle and Leslie have been making all kinds of real estate moves over the last few years. During the summer of 2018, they dropped about a million bucks on a big house on 21 semi-remote acres in rural central Washington, and the spring of 2019, around the same time they bought the Silver Lake house they are now selling, they shelled out $2.1 million for a secluded hilltop spread in Topanga, Calif., that they lickety-split sold about 1.5 years later for $1.85 million, a notable quarter-million-dollar loss not counting improvement expenses and real estate fees. And finally, not quite a year ago, the couple upgraded — and more than doubled their square footage — with the 7,200-square foot Barbara Bestor-designed home they bought for $5.7 million from actress Katie Aselton and Hollywood polymath Mark Duplass.
